Hilton Waikiki Beach Hotel is looking for a charismatic service professional to join our team. Under the direction of Engineering Management, responsible to keep all equipment in good repair with a minimum downtime by providing regular maintenance of all areas of the hotel to provide a clean, safe and well-maintained hotel for guests while maintaining regulatory compliance. Performs minor to journeyman level repairs and maintenance. This includes but not limited to: To repair and maintain all areas of the hotel including guest rooms, public areas, ballrooms, and function/meeting rooms, kitchens, restaurants, executive offices, back of house, roofs, parking, and electrical and mechanical rooms. Respond and complete guest calls in a timely manner. Assist with any special assignments.
